I have a few tips you could use, for motivation this is the main one that kepted me going. I usually quit after a month but even though I have gain since September when I started this eat healthy journey. Frist write down your goal and your reason of why you want it. For each quest imagin what it will feel like. Q1) What is the PAIN you expect if you make this change? This can be pain from the experience of making the change and / or the pain you would experience if you did reach your goal? For example mind would be to falling completely Q2) What is the PLEASURE have experience by Not making this change or committing to this goal? what benifit do you receive from having this problem? ( For example, it could be attention, ability to eat what you want, or any other secret reason you don't want to change) Mind is eating chocolate brownies 😋😅 Q3) What is the PAIN that will happen if you DO Not reach your goal? How will it impact your life, your career, your Family? Mine is Spending lots of money on new clothes. Q4) What is the PLEASURE you will experience when you reach your goal and reap the benefits? How will your life be Better? How will you Feel? What weight will you be lifted of your shoulders ? What other important outcomes will come from this? For example one of mine is being able to wear summer clothes and not feel embarrassed.
